2016-03-03 3 views
1

Прежде всего, я не знаю, как работают или сконфигурированы компоненты AWS. Я просто проектирую архитектуру с верхней точки зрения, а затем некоторые sysadmin собираются ее реализовать.AWS ELB для нескольких EC2 с субдоменами

Если у меня есть ELB и экземпляры EC2 либо запустить сервер HTTPS или принимать WSS соединения с помощью групповой сертификат (server1.domain.com, server2.domain.com ...), если ELB слушать разные порты (например, ELB: 443 -> server1, ELB: 444 server2 ...) или он может прослушивать только до 443 и 8080 (для WSS), а затем перенаправить на конкретный сервер?

ответ

0

ELB не работает. ELB будет принимать запросы и пересылать их на любой экземпляр EC2, который прослушивает его. Вы не можете направлять запросы к конкретным экземплярам EC2 каким-либо образом (порт, домен и т. Д.).

Если вы хотите, чтобы определенные домены отправлялись в определенные экземпляры EC2, вы либо сопоставляли бы свой домен с экземплярами EC2 напрямую через ваш DNS-сервер (и использовали бы Elastic IP-адреса), либо у вас были бы отдельные ELB-интерфейсы разных Экземпляры EC2.

+0

, но имеет смысл иметь многослойные балансировочные балансиры? – yzT

+0

Да, если у вас несколько открытых сайтов –

Смежные вопросы